Elevating Standards: Certified Stringers in South Africa
In the dynamic realm of journalism, where accuracy and timeliness are paramount, the role of a stringer proves invaluable. These freelance journalists, often residing across various regions, provide immediate news reports to media organizations. South Africa, renowned for its diverse landscape and vibrant news environment, has seen a growing focus on elevating the standards of stringer performance.
A certification program has emerged to strengthen the skills of stringers. This initiative aims to guarantee that stringers possess the required journalistic values, understanding of reporting standards, and capacity to produce reliable content.
The accreditation process typically entails a combination of theoretical examinations, hands-on assignments, and assessments by experienced journalists. Successful completion of the program evidences a stringer's resolve to upholding journalistic integrity and producing trustworthy content.
By focusing in certified stringers, media establishments can improve the reliability of their news reporting. This, in turn, serves the public by providing them with accurate information upon which they can make informed decisions.
